SAFETY DEVICES P/SEC/PXS59 * * 0/B/23/05/2001 page 1 / 2 GB UL PXS59 . . 0 CODED MAGNETIC SAFETY SENSOR (1 "O" contact + 1 "C" contact ) These sensors perform safety when opening protection hoods or covers on dangerous machinery. Associated with its coded magnet P2000100 and a monitoring unit capable to watch 1 contact "O" ( NO, closed with magnet ) and 1 contact "C" ( NC, opened with magnet ), it complies with European directives to conform machines according to norms EN 60204 - EN 1088 - EN 954; with the appropriate monitoring unit, it can perform safety function of category 3 or 4 according to EN 954 " Safety of machinery ". Safety functions : Fraud : the sensor, associated with its coded magnet P2000100, allows to reduce possibilities of fraudulent actions; Standard magnet cannot actuate the sensor. Redundancy : Components are redundant. If one of parts of the sensor is defective , the redundant circuit goes on running. Discordance : A monitoring unit will check if the sensor signals come up in a specific order. If not, an alarm will be given. Activation next to magnetic parts : magnetic material used near the magnet or the sensor alters switching airgaps. In any ca se, use an insulating block. In the same way, it's recommended to respect a minimal distance of about 2,5 mm between the componants. The sensor must not be used as a mechanical stop. Operating cycle : when the magnet comes near the sensor, contact "O" is closing after contact "C" has opened. when the magnet moves away, contact "O" is opening before contact "C" has closed.
